CookieAuthenticationOptions,ExpireTimeSpan不起作用
发布时间:2020-05-30 06:29:21 所属栏目:asp.Net 来源:互联网
导读:我有以下代码: public void ConfigureAuth(IAppBuilder app) { app.UseCookieAuthentication(new CookieAuthenticationOptions { AuthenticationType = DefaultAuthenticationTypes.Appli
|
我有以下代码: public void ConfigureAuth(IAppBuilder app)
{
app.UseCookieAuthentication(new CookieAuthenticationOptions
{
AuthenticationType = DefaultAuthenticationTypes.ApplicationCookie,ExpireTimeSpan = System.TimeSpan.FromMinutes(1),LoginPath = new PathString("/Account/Login"),LogoutPath = new PathString("/Account/LogOff")
});
但登录会话活动超过1分钟.此外,当时间到期时,LogoutPath不会被调用.为什么? 解决方法它到期了.确保您没有任何背景ajax活动,因为它扩展了会话(默认情况下,SlidingExpiration为true). 此外,我将ExpireTimeSpan从the default 14 days更改为较小的值后,我必须手动删除旧的Cookie. (编辑:安卓应用网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
推荐文章
站长推荐
- asp.net – IIS 7.5不加载静态html页面
- asp.net-mvc – MVC – 重定向在构造函数内
- asp.net-mvc – 如何使用MSBuild部署一个ASP.NET
- asp.net-mvc – 使用jQuery getJson发送list/arr
- asp.net-mvc – asp.net mvc ajax post – redir
- asp.net-mvc – 如何将URL参数绑定到具有不同名称
- 如何将ASP.NET MVC5身份认证添加到现有数据库
- 为什么我的ASP.NET项目不会在启动项目中运行在开
- asp.net-mvc – @Model和@model之间的区别
- asp.net – 如何使用带有TemplateFields的Object
热点阅读
